Hermes's skill loader (agent/skill_utils.skill_matches_platform) already honors the 'platforms:' frontmatter field and skip-loads skills whose declared platform list doesn't include sys.platform. Seven bundled skills are in fact Linux/macOS-only but never declared it, so they leak into Windows skill listings and sometimes load with broken instructions. Audited all 160 SKILL.md files (skills/ + optional-skills/) for Windows- hostile signals: apt-get/brew/systemd/chmod+x install flows, ptrace/proc runtime dependencies, bash-only launcher scripts, and package dependencies with no Windows build. The 7 below fail one or more of those tests in a way that fundamentally can't be papered over by docs edits: minecraft-modpack-server bash start.sh + chmod +x + apt openjdk evaluating-llms-harness lm-eval-harness bash launcher scripts distributed-llm-pretraining- torchtitan bash multi-node torchrun launcher python-debugpy remote attach relies on /proc ptrace_scope pytorch-fsdp NCCL backend; Windows path is WSL only tensorrt-llm NVIDIA TensorRT-LLM has no Windows build searxng-search Docker volume flow assumes POSIX $(pwd) All seven get 'platforms: [linux, macos]'. On Windows the loader now skips them silently — no more phantom skill listings, no more mid-task failures because an Apple-only path was surfaced as a suggestion. Cross-platform skills that merely CONTAIN signals in examples or install-instructions (brew install as one of several paths, /tmp/ in a code snippet, etc.) are NOT touched by this commit. A broader audit that declares the ~140 cross-platform skills as 'platforms: [linux, macos, windows]' can follow as a separate change once each has been verified working on Windows. The installed user copies under ~/AppData/Local/hermes/skills/ (when they exist) are also patched so the running session reflects the gating immediately, but only the in-repo files are committed here. |
